This conference offered students the opportunity to hear some of the nation’s best speakers on conservative ideas in beautiful Chicago, Illinois. Speakers addressed such topics as free markets, limited government, national defense, personal responsibility, traditional values, and the ideas and principles of President Ronald Reagan. We are proud to have the Illinois Policy Institute, the Heartland Institute and the Mackinac Center as co-sponsors of this event.

The conference is the largest one of its type on the Midwest, offering an abundance of books, resources, and networking opportunities that create a gateway to the Conservative Movement.
